
Amol Muzumdar
Amol Muzumdar is a former Indian cricketer and current head coach of the Indian women's national cricket team. He is known for his extensive domestic career, having scored over 11,000 runs in first-class cricket, and has been instrumental in nurturing young talent in Indian cricket. Under his coaching, the women's team has shown significant improvement, culminating in impressive performances in international tournaments, including the Women's World Cup.
